Freigeben über


IdentityServiceCollectionExtensions.AddIdentity Methode

Definition

Überlädt

AddIdentity<TUser,TRole>(IServiceCollection)

Fügt die Standardkonfiguration des Identitätssystems für die angegebenen Benutzer- und Rollentypen hinzu.

AddIdentity<TUser,TRole>(IServiceCollection, Action<IdentityOptions>)
AddIdentity<TUser,TRole>(IServiceCollection, Action<IdentityOptions>)

Fügt das Identitätssystem für die angegebenen Benutzer- und Rollentypen hinzu und konfiguriert es.

AddIdentity<TUser,TRole>(IServiceCollection)

Quelle:
IdentityServiceCollectionExtensions.cs
Quelle:
IdentityServiceCollectionExtensions.cs
Quelle:
IdentityServiceCollectionExtensions.cs

Fügt die Standardkonfiguration des Identitätssystems für die angegebenen Benutzer- und Rollentypen hinzu.

public static Microsoft.AspNetCore.Identity.IdentityBuilder AddIdentity<TUser,TRole> (this Microsoft.Extensions.DependencyInjection.IServiceCollection services) where TUser : class where TRole : class;
static member AddIdentity : Microsoft.Extensions.DependencyInjection.IServiceCollection -> Microsoft.AspNetCore.Identity.IdentityBuilder (requires 'User : null and 'Role : null)
<Extension()>
Public Function AddIdentity(Of TUser As Class, TRole As Class) (services As IServiceCollection) As IdentityBuilder

Typparameter

TUser

Der Typ, der einen Benutzer im System darstellt.

TRole

Der Typ, der eine Rolle im System darstellt.

Parameter

services
IServiceCollection

Die in der Anwendung verfügbaren Dienste.

Gibt zurück

Ein IdentityBuilder zum Erstellen und Konfigurieren des Identitätssystems.

Gilt für:

AddIdentity<TUser,TRole>(IServiceCollection, Action<IdentityOptions>)

public static Microsoft.AspNetCore.Identity.IdentityBuilder AddIdentity<TUser,TRole> (this Microsoft.Extensions.DependencyInjection.IServiceCollection services, Action<Microsoft.AspNetCore.Builder.IdentityOptions> setupAction) where TUser : class where TRole : class;
static member AddIdentity : Microsoft.Extensions.DependencyInjection.IServiceCollection * Action<Microsoft.AspNetCore.Builder.IdentityOptions> -> Microsoft.AspNetCore.Identity.IdentityBuilder (requires 'User : null and 'Role : null)
<Extension()>
Public Function AddIdentity(Of TUser As Class, TRole As Class) (services As IServiceCollection, setupAction As Action(Of IdentityOptions)) As IdentityBuilder

Typparameter

TUser
TRole

Parameter

setupAction
Action<IdentityOptions>

Gibt zurück

Gilt für:

AddIdentity<TUser,TRole>(IServiceCollection, Action<IdentityOptions>)

Quelle:
IdentityServiceCollectionExtensions.cs
Quelle:
IdentityServiceCollectionExtensions.cs
Quelle:
IdentityServiceCollectionExtensions.cs

Fügt das Identitätssystem für die angegebenen Benutzer- und Rollentypen hinzu und konfiguriert es.

public static Microsoft.AspNetCore.Identity.IdentityBuilder AddIdentity<TUser,TRole> (this Microsoft.Extensions.DependencyInjection.IServiceCollection services, Action<Microsoft.AspNetCore.Identity.IdentityOptions> setupAction) where TUser : class where TRole : class;
static member AddIdentity : Microsoft.Extensions.DependencyInjection.IServiceCollection * Action<Microsoft.AspNetCore.Identity.IdentityOptions> -> Microsoft.AspNetCore.Identity.IdentityBuilder (requires 'User : null and 'Role : null)
<Extension()>
Public Function AddIdentity(Of TUser As Class, TRole As Class) (services As IServiceCollection, setupAction As Action(Of IdentityOptions)) As IdentityBuilder

Typparameter

TUser

Der Typ, der einen Benutzer im System darstellt.

TRole

Der Typ, der eine Rolle im System darstellt.

Parameter

services
IServiceCollection

Die in der Anwendung verfügbaren Dienste.

setupAction
Action<IdentityOptions>

Eine Aktion zum Konfigurieren von IdentityOptions.

Gibt zurück

Ein IdentityBuilder zum Erstellen und Konfigurieren des Identitätssystems.

Gilt für: